Background:

  • Cryptococcal meningitis is a significant global infectious disease, strongly linked to HIV/AIDS.
  • While prevalent in adults, its incidence in children is notably lower, with limited research available, particularly in sub-Saharan Africa.
  • Sub-Saharan Africa has the highest global prevalence of HIV-infected children, underscoring a critical research gap.

Purpose of the Study:

  • To summarize cases of cryptococcal meningitis in children diagnosed at a tertiary hospital in Harare, Zimbabwe.
  • To contribute to the limited body of knowledge on pediatric cryptococcal meningitis in sub-Saharan Africa.

Main Methods:

  • A retrospective case series was conducted.
  • Data from five pediatric patients diagnosed with cryptococcal meningitis between October 1, 2013, and September 30, 2014, were summarized.

Main Results:

  • Five cases of cryptococcal meningitis in children were identified and analyzed.
  • The study provides initial data on pediatric cryptococcal meningitis in a Zimbabwean tertiary care setting.

Conclusions:

  • Pediatric cryptococcal meningitis, though rare, occurs in regions with high HIV prevalence.
  • Further research is essential to understand and manage cryptococcal meningitis in HIV-infected children in sub-Saharan Africa.

Viral Meningitis

Viral meningitis is the most common form of meningitis and is often referred to as aseptic meningitis to indicate the absence of bacterial involvement. It is generally milder than bacterial meningitis, with symptoms including fever, headache, stiff neck, drowsiness, nausea, photophobia, and vomiting. Immunodeficiency Diseases

Immunodeficiency disorders are conditions in which the immune system's ability to fight infectious disease and cancer is compromised or entirely absent. The immune system comprises a complex network of cells, tissues, and organs that work together to protect the body from potentially harmful invaders. When this system is deficient or not functioning properly, it leaves the body susceptible to infections, diseases, or other complications.

Pulmonary Tuberculosis I

Tuberculosis, often called TB, is a contagious illness primarily caused by Mycobacterium tuberculosis. It mainly affects the lung parenchyma but can also impact other body parts.
Causative Organism
The primary infectious agent causing tuberculosis is Mycobacterium tuberculosis, a slow-growing, acid-fast, aerobic rod that exhibits sensitivity to heat and ultraviolet light. Instances of Mycobacterium bovis and Mycobacterium avium contributing to the development of TB infection are rare.

Cytomegalovirus Disease

Cytomegalovirus (CMV) disease is caused by human cytomegalovirus, a double-stranded DNA virus of the Herpesviridae family. While primary CMV infection is often asymptomatic in immunocompetent individuals, the virus can cause severe disease in neonates and immunocompromised patients. Fungal Phylum Microsporidia

Microsporidia are a group of obligate intracellular fungi that were initially classified as protists but were later reclassified based on phylogenetic, molecular, and structural evidence linking them to the Chytridiomycota. These unicellular, non-motile organisms are highly specialized parasites that infect a wide range of animal hosts, including humans. Retrovirus Life Cycles

Retroviruses have a single-stranded RNA genome that undergoes a special form of replication. Once the retrovirus has entered the host cell, an enzyme called reverse transcriptase synthesizes double-stranded DNA from the retroviral RNA genome. This DNA copy of the genome is then integrated into the host’s genome inside the nucleus via an enzyme called integrase.
